Output 84ec8167de029640e4e4fb391489af3fd611f7eee95bd7eea2b48211c4fa351d:2

value
13823051
script pubkey
OP_0 OP_PUSHBYTES_20 a4fd053ae47b96319751423c79d1d740bc4cd25a
address
bc1q5n7s2why0wtrr963gg78n5whgz7ye5j6e29jr6
transaction
84ec8167de029640e4e4fb391489af3fd611f7eee95bd7eea2b48211c4fa351d
spent
true